WebOct 26, 2024 · Outline of the PAR-CLIP methodology. PAR-CLIP begins with incorporation of photoactivatable thioribonucleosides into nascent transcripts followed by crosslinking with long-wavelength > 310 nm UV. Next, the cells are lysed and the RNAs are partially digested to obtain RNA fragments in an optimal size range ( Fig. 1, steps 2 and 3). tinkercad import libraryWebPAR-CLIP maps RBP sites on the target RNAs. This approach is similar to HITS-CLIP and CLIP-Seq, but it uses much more efficient crosslinking to stabilize the protein-RNA complexes.
